By default the text search of archived enquiries permits you to
search on the Enquiry Title only. To enable a search on all the
enquiry fields it is first necessary to enable Full Text Search
on the database. This can only be done directly on the SQL database
by the database administrator in your IT department. It cannot
be done by using MiDatabank.
The following instructions are for a DBA (Database Administrator)
using Microsoft SQL Server.
Instructions for Database Administrator
Create a Full-Text Catalog for the mi database that contains
indexes for the following tables:
Enquiries
ResearchResults
EnquiryKeywords
EnquiryNotes
Include all available fields for the indexes on the above
tables.
Ensure that you populate the catalog, and set an appropriate
population schedule for the catalog (e.g. every night at 2am).
Once FTS has been enabled, clicking on Search in the Enquiry
Manager application will display a window titled 'Search Enquiries
(Full Text Search Enabled)' that contains a checkbox called 'Search
